Went to a craft class on Friday at The Glitterpot near Haywards Heath with my friend Pam. We had a great day making cards with Julie Hickey from Craftwork Cards. We used their 'Yummy Scrummy paper range which is beautiful. The first 2 cards were made with the 'Coffee & Cream' range.
The card on the left has an acetate butterfly that has been stamped using Stazon Opaque white ink. Now being a very novice & I mean novice stamper I was surprised how easy it was to stamp and how effective it looked.


















In the afternoon we used the Marshmellow & Cappuccino range which I thought was a wired combination to start with but looked stunning together.
The first one we did was supposed to be put together to make concetina book but I have decided to keep mine separated and make 3 cards. The second card was made by cutting up 9 squares and adding some embellishments. I would never have thought of doing a card like this as it's a little fussy to what I normally do but I really liked it. The centres of the flowers are called Card Candy which are fab! and at only £1 a bag, is a bargain as well!!

When we had finished these cards Jane set us a challenge to make a small card using some of the papers and embellishments. This is the card I made.
